سلام
یه ماتریس 10در 10 دارم که کاربر باید پر کنه داخلشو (هر فیلدی که دوست داشت رو پر کنه)
به نظرتون چطور میتونم ورودی از کاربر بگیرم و توش پر کنم که جالب باشه مثلا کاربر یه چیزی مثله گرید ویو ببینه و توش پر کنه و بره تو ماتریس
Printable View
سلام
یه ماتریس 10در 10 دارم که کاربر باید پر کنه داخلشو (هر فیلدی که دوست داشت رو پر کنه)
به نظرتون چطور میتونم ورودی از کاربر بگیرم و توش پر کنم که جالب باشه مثلا کاربر یه چیزی مثله گرید ویو ببینه و توش پر کنه و بره تو ماتریس
سلام
یه جدول 10 * 10 با تکست باکس بسازید! اگه هم خاستید یکم رو گرافیکش کار کنید!
به نظر من بهتره به جای تعداد زیادی تکست باکس از دیتاگرید استفاده کنی بهتره چون با ایندکس های سطر و ستون میتونی به سلول های گرید دسترسی پیدا کرد کار راحت تر انجام میشود
چطور میتونیم به اندیس هاش دسترسی داشته باشیم؟ میشه تکه کدشو بهم بدین که به سطر و ستونش رو مشخص کرده؟
فرض نام دیتاگرید رو gv جهت راحتی گذاشتیم این کدی که گذاشتم نحوه دسترسی به سلول ها هست .جمع تمام درایه های ماتریس (دیتاگرید) رو حساب میکنه
int sum = 0;
for (int i = 0; i < gv.RowCount; i++)
{
for (int j = 0; j < gv.ColumnCount; j++)
{
sum += Convert.ToInt32(gv.Rows[i].Cells[j].Value);
}
}
متشکرم .مشکلم تقریبا حل شد